Some boat have and some boats don't. Even same manufacturer, same year, and same model can vary greatly.

Another factor is: what's your tolerance for gelcoat crazing and do you plan to fix it?

Gelcoat cracks are very hard to photograph, so that could be a poor indicator. Can't say it would work, but I'd explain to the seller that I'm going to be traveling 4 hours to look at it, and would like to know in advance whether it's worth the trip. Seems like a good communicator could let you know if there are un-countable cracks everywhere, or a finite number of them in certain locations. If her can't give you a good description, I wouldn't make the trip.
